HEPA filters
Known for their high efficiency, HEPA filters remove 99.97% of airborne particles such as dust, mold spores, and allergens. They are ideal for individuals with respiratory issues but may require professional installation. Prices range from $10 to $75 based on size and quality.

UV sterilization filters
Using ultraviolet light, these filters eliminate germs, viruses, and bacteria. They are less effective against dust and allergens and are often combined with other filters. Prices vary from $60 to $225, but prolonged use can pose health risks.

Washable filters
Eco-friendly and cost-saving, washable filters last long, are easy to clean, and suitable for home use. They should be washed periodically and dried before reuse. Costs generally fall between $30 and $60 or more, offering a durable and efficient filtering solution.

Spun glass filters
Commonly used in HVAC systems, spun glass filters are affordable options that effectively remove dust and larger debris. They are less capable of filtering bacteria and allergens, making them less suitable for allergy sufferers. Prices start around $10 and are easy to maintain and dispose of.

Electrostatic filters
Utilizing electrical charges, these filters attract and trap airborne particles, including allergens. Reusable and replaceable, they are budget-friendly and effective for allergy-prone individuals. Prices range from $13 to over $1,000 depending on specifications.
